During the Community Tech Days 2010 held at Kochi, K-MUG decided to conduct monthly user group meeting for Central Kerala region at Kochi. First meeting was conducted on Nov 13, 2010 and the venue was Mastermind Institute of Engineering,  Kakkanad, Kochi. I was given a chance by the K-MUG people to take a session on Windows Phone 7. 

Although I had started making slides and creating some demo applications, last minutes hiccups is unavoidable. The case is no different here, I didn’t wanted any issues to surface during the presentation coz of my unstable development machine, so I decided to demo the application inside a VM. For that I created a new one with Windows 7 64-bit as OS and then went on to install the Windows Phone Developer Toolkit which is a free download from MSDN. Even though I had 3GB memory and a dual core processor, it took a pretty decent time to install. But to my horror, I found out that the application is not loading in the emulator after a successful build. So after googling for a while I was able to get the problem behind that, Windows Phone Emulator will not work properly in a VM. The time was almost midnight and I had to catch the early morning train, so I decided to show it in my machine come what may. 

Next morning I got up early and reached the station in time. During  the journey I decided to go through the ppts and demo applications and made sure that everyone is working fine.
